bzr 0.92rc1
Changes
bzr
now returns exit code 4 if an internal error occurred, and
3 if a normal error occurred. (Martin Pool)
pull
, merge
and push
will no longer silently correct some
repository index errors that occured as a result of the Weave disk format.
Instead the reconcile
command needs to be run to correct those
problems if they exist (and it has been able to fix most such problems
since bzr 0.8). Some new problems have been identified during this release
and you should run bzr check
once on every repository to see if you
need to reconcile. If you cannot pull
or merge
from a remote
repository due to mismatched parent errors - a symptom of index errors -
you should simply take a full copy of that remote repository to a clean
directory outside any local repositories, then run reconcile on it, and
finally pull from it locally. (And naturally email the repositories owner
to ask them to upgrade and run reconcile).
(Robert Collins)
Features
- New
knitpack-experimental
repository format. This is interoperable with
the dirstate-tags
format but uses a smarter storage design that greatly
speeds up many operations, both local and remote. This new format can be
used as an option to the init
, init-repository
and upgrade
commands. (Robert Collins)
- For users of bzr-svn (and those testing the prototype subtree support) that
wish to try packs, a new
knitpack-subtree-experimental
format has also
been added. This is interoperable with the dirstate-subtrees
format.
(Robert Collins)
- New
reconfigure
command. (Aaron Bentley)
- New
revert --forget-merges
command, which removes the record of a pending
merge without affecting the working tree contents. (Martin Pool)
- New
bzr_remote_path
configuration variable allows finer control of
remote bzr locations than BZR_REMOTE_PATH environment variable.
(Aaron Bentley)
- New
launchpad-login
command to tell Bazaar your Launchpad
user ID. This can then be used by other functions of the
Launchpad plugin. (James Henstridge)

Bug Fixes
- Connection error reporting for the smart server has been fixed to
display a user friendly message instead of a traceback.
(Ian Clatworthy, #115601)
- Make sure to use
O_BINARY
when opening files to check their
sha1sum. (Alexander Belchenko, John Arbash Meinel, #153493)
- Fix a problem with Win32 handling of the executable bit.
(John Arbash Meinel, #149113)
bzr+ssh://
and sftp://
URLs that do not specify ports explicitly
no longer assume that means port 22. This allows people using OpenSSH to
override the default port in their ~/.ssh/config
if they wish. This
fixes a bug introduced in bzr 0.91. (Andrew Bennetts, #146715)
- Commands reporting exceptions can now be profiled and still have their
data correctly dumped to a file. For example, a
bzr commit
with
no changes still reports the operation as pointless but doing so no
longer throws away the profiling data if this command is run with
--lsprof-file callgrind.out.ci
say. (Ian Clatworthy)
- Fallback to FTP when paramiko is not installed and SFTP can’t be used for
tests/commands
so that the test suite is still usable without
paramiko.
(Vincent Ladeuil, #59150)

API Breaks
bzrlib.index.GraphIndex
now requires a size parameter to the
constructor, for enabling bisection searches. (Robert Collins)
CommitBuilder.record_entry_contents
now requires the root entry of a
tree be supplied to it, previously failing to do so would trigger a
deprecation warning. (Robert Collins)
KnitVersionedFile.add*
will no longer cache added records even when
enable_cache() has been called - the caching feature is now exclusively for
reading existing data. (Robert Collins)
ReadOnlyLockError
is deprecated; LockFailed
is usually more
appropriate. (Martin Pool)
- Removed
bzrlib.transport.TransportLogger
- please see the new
trace+
transport instead. (Robert Collins)
- Removed previously deprecated varargs interface to
TestCase.run_bzr
and
deprecated methods TestCase.capture
and TestCase.run_bzr_captured
.
(Martin Pool)
- Removed previous deprecated
basis_knit
parameter to the
KnitVersionedFile
constructor. (Robert Collins)
- Special purpose method
TestCase.run_bzr_decode
is moved to the test_non_ascii
class that needs it.
(Martin Pool)
- The class
bzrlib.repofmt.knitrepo.KnitRepository3
has been folded into
KnitRepository
by parameters to the constructor. (Robert Collins)
- The
VersionedFile
interface now allows content checks to be bypassed
by supplying check_content=False. This saves nearly 30% of the minimum
cost to store a version of a file. (Robert Collins)
- Tree’s with bad state such as files with no length or sha will no longer
be silently accepted by the repository XML serialiser. To serialise
inventories without such data, pass working=True to write_inventory.
(Robert Collins)
VersionedFile.fix_parents
has been removed as a harmful API.
VersionedFile.join
will no longer accept different parents on either
side of a join - it will either ignore them, or error, depending on the
implementation. See notes when upgrading for more information.
(Robert Collins)
